Abstract

The invention discloses a disc fixation extrusion pad assembly of an extruder. The disc fixation extrusion pad assembly is arranged on the front end of an extrusion rod, comprises an extrusion pad, and is characterized in that the end surface of the extrusion rod is provided with a fixation pad connection key, an extrusion pad fixation pad is positioned through the fixation pad connection key, and the extrusion pad is movably arranged on the end part of the extrusion pad fixation pad. Compared to the traditional design, the disc fixation extrusion pad assembly of the present invention has the following advantages that: the relative change is less, the modification cost is low, the structure is simple, the processing cost and the use cost are substantially reduced, and the time required for replacement repair is reduced, such that the production efficiency can be ensured so as to provide a good popularization value.

Background technology
Along with improving constantly of extruder automatization level, as the crucial prerequisite of extruder fully automatic operation, the application of fixation extrusion pad is also increasingly extensive.At present, fixation extrusion pad generally adopts the expansion type combining structure.When this structure is utilized bracer front pressurized with the expansion central shoring greatly reaching sealing to the ingot-containing tube extrusion chamber, design is comparatively complicated and machining accuracy and installation accuracy all had very high requirement.And because each extruding; Bracer and expansion loop are directly all wanted repeated friction; So the wearing and tearing between the contact position are very big, the gap that wearing and tearing produce is also sneaked into assorted bits, the service life of reducing a whole set of dummy block greatly easily; Also strengthened the difficulty of dismounting when changing, serious even can cause a whole set of fixed press pad assembly to scrap.Therefore, the use cost of expansion type fixation extrusion pad is higher relatively.
